perf(parquet): reuse delta PutSpaced scratch (#1230)
## What
- Reuse an allocator-backed scratch buffer in
`deltaBitPackEncoder.PutSpaced`.
- Keep the buffer capacity between calls and release it with the
encoder.
- Keep the existing compaction path unchanged.
## Benchmark
Apple M1 Pro, Go 1.26.3. Steady-state repeated `PutSpaced` plus
`FlushValues` calls on the same encoder, with 10% nulls. Scratch growth
is done before timing.
Command: `go test -vet=off ./parquet/internal/encoding -run "^$" -bench
"^BenchmarkDeltaBinaryPackedPutSpaced(Int32|Int64)$" -benchmem
-benchtime=300ms -count=3 -cpu=1`
| Type | Length | Before | After |
| --- | ---: | ---: | ---: |
| INT32 | 1,024 | 5,333 B/op, 36 allocs/op | 469 B/op, 35 allocs/op |
| INT32 | 65,536 | 282,188 B/op, 1,851 allocs/op | 11,836 B/op, 1,850
allocs/op |
| INT64 | 1,024 | 9,941 B/op, 36 allocs/op | 469 B/op, 35 allocs/op |
| INT64 | 65,536 | 544,346 B/op, 1,851 allocs/op | 11,836 B/op, 1,850
allocs/op |
## Tests
- `go test ./parquet/internal/encoding -count=1`
- `PARQUET_TEST_DATA=parquet-testing/data go test ./... -count=1`
